What Sets Do Good Farms Apart?

Do Good Farms stand out from traditional farms due to their commitment to several core principles. Firstly, they prioritize sustainable practices that minimize environmental impact. This includes organic farming methods, crop rotation, and the use of natural fertilizers and pesticides. By doing so, these farms help preserve soil health, reduce water usage, and decrease greenhouse gas emissions.

Secondly, Do Good Farms emphasize the importance of animal welfare. They raise livestock in humane conditions, ensuring that animals have access to clean water, proper nutrition, and enough space to roam. This not only results in healthier animals but also produces higher-quality, more nutritious products for consumers.

Community and Social Responsibility

In addition to environmental and animal welfare, Do Good Farms also focus on community and social responsibility. They often work with local farmers and suppliers, creating a network of sustainable food producers. By supporting local economies, these farms help create jobs and stimulate community growth.

Moreover, Do Good Farms are dedicated to educating the public about sustainable agriculture. They offer workshops, tours, and educational programs that help people understand the importance of sustainable farming and the benefits it brings to both the environment and society.
